Whether you seek an intimate getaway for two, or a family vacation for 10, the newly-built, 3,200-square foot Casa de Colores and its 600-square foot, two-story casita (Casita de Colores) are perfect for you. Situated on the North end of Half Moon Bay with magnificent, unobstructed views of the Caribbean, Casa de Colores sleeps up to 10 in the main house and two in the casita. Mexico is about color, and Casa de Colores does not disappoint – its vibrant, contemporary design is accented with the exciting colors of the Yucatan Peninsula – from décor to lovely linens.
In the main house, two top floor master bedrooms with king-sized beds and en-suite baths offer complete privacy, as well as sleek, double glass bowl countertop sinks and terraces overlooking the Caribbean. A family room between the master suites also has stunning views and can be a cozy getaway, complete with flat screen TV/DVD. It is beautifully furnished with a comfortable sofa/chaise lounge.
Two additional bedrooms on the first floor have identical private bathrooms with exquisitely tiled showers and above-counter sinks and fixtures. The Caribbean-facing bedroom offers a king-sized bed and terrace; the second bedroom offers an ocean view, but faces the aqua- and cobalt-tiled 10’ x 30’ swimming pool and cool consuela-tiled surrounding terrace. It has both a Mexican queen-sized bed and futon sofa that sleeps two. While the incredible breezes off the ocean naturally cool the interior, all bedrooms are air-conditioned, and all rooms in Casa de Colores and its casita have ceiling fans.
The spectacular living and dining rooms also offer Caribbean views along with contemporary, ultra-comfortable furnishings. You’ll enjoy sinking into the hot red sofas after a day of snorkeling in Yal Ku Lagoon, a short walk away, or swimming in Half Moon Bay, about 100 yards from Casa de Colores. Both have spectacular tropical fish, coral and turtles.
The stainless steel and granite kitchen, complete with dishwasher, features a breakfast counter with four bar stools as well as a center island. The sleek dining room table seats up to 10.
The Casa de Colores casita can be rented in combination with the main house. It overlooks the pool, but both the first floor living room and second floor bedroom have Caribbean views. The casita is comfortably furnished with a beautiful blue sofa and upholstered striped chair. It has a flat screen TV. The kitchen is also stainless and granite and the dining area seats two. The bedroom offers a king-sized bed and beautiful bathroom with aqua-tiled shower and above-counter, contemporary sink and fixtures.
There are three iPod docking stations in the casa, and one in the casita.
